Our values are written on cards we all carry; they hang in our break rooms, in our … WebJan 17, 2024 · Inclusion refers to how people feel at work. A company’s workforce may be diverse, but if employees do not feel safe, welcomed, and valued, that company isn’t inclusive and will not perform to its highest potential.
